To facilitate finding the position of any vessel in the Harbour, the Anchorage in divided into eight Sections, commencing at Green Island: Vessels near the Hongkong there are marked ., near the Kowloong.shore k., and those in the body of the Shipping or midway between each shore are marked c., in conjunction with the figures denoting the sections,

Section,

1. From Green Taland to the Gas Works.

2. From Gas Works to the Novelty Iron Works.

3. From Novelty Iron Works to the Harbour Master's Office. 4. From Barbour Master's to the P. and O. Co.'s Office,
